FS2004 Douglas A4 Skyhawk panel and gauges
==========================================

Photorealistic freeware FS2004 panel for Douglas A4 Skyhawk by Jean-Pierre Langer and Arne Bartels based on photos taken on an A4-N at Nimes-Garons airport. Specific gauges have been made for this panel which also uses the default FS2004 GPS and the great F-16 HUD made by William Lipscomb. This panel has been made to be used with the excellent RAZBAM Skyhawks, but should work with other Skyhawks.

Installation :
--------------
1) Unzip the archive in a temporary directory.

2) Put all the elements of the panel folder in your Skyhawk panel folder

3) Put all the gauges from the gauges folder into the main FS2004 gauges folder.

Flight model :
--------------
My friend Bee Gee has adapted the Skyhawk A4-C flight model (RAZBAM series 1) according informations given by the A4 pilot of Nimes-Garons. If you want to use it (but it is not mandatory), just replace the original aircraft.cfg and A4C.air files by the one included in the "aircraft A4C" folder. Don't forget to make a backup of the original files.

Utilisation :
-------------
As this panel has many views, never load the Skyhawk as first plane when you launch FS. Load the default FS plane then change to the Skyhawk. If you don't do that, you may have the GPS, throttle and other subpanels hiden by the IFR, VFR, or Landing views.
Note :As the original plane has a GPS instead of an HSI, by default it's the GPS which appears on the panel, but you can switch it to an HSI and OMI.
